About E-Line Media:
E-Line Media is a developer and publisher of video games with meaningful themes and authentic voices. Founded in 2008, the company's mission is to develop games that fire the imagination, catalyze curiosity, and provide gateways to new perspectives and interests.
The Company is a mission-driven, for-profit enterprise whose investors seek market-level financial returns and positive social impact. Its titles include the BAFTA and Peabody award-winning Never Alone , the Jackson-Wild-winning Beyond Blue , Gamestar Mechanic, and MinecraftEDU .
The Emirati Cultural Game will be a project similar to E-Line's Never Alone, which was developed inclusively with the Cook Inlet Tribal Council (CITC), a pioneering Alaska Native organization. Never Alone's goal was to share, celebrate, and extend Alaska Native culture with a global audience. The game is based on a story passed down for thousands of years, is in the Inupiaq language, and features 24 'cultural insight' mini-documentaries unlocked through gameplay, inviting players to connect deeply with Alaska Native heritage and tradition.
The game has resonated worldwide, reaching over 15 million players. It has been featured in thousands of articles, won numerous awards, and is in the permanent collection of the Museum of Modern Art in New York City.

About the Project:
We are embarking on an exciting journey to create a video game inspired by Emirati culture, featuring compelling gameplay and an authentic narrative. Our goal is to create an experience that resonates with both global and local players while honoring the cultural heritage and traditions of the UAE. We are bringing together experienced game developers alongside Emirati artists, storytellers, and cultural partners to create a commercially successful, engaging experience for audiences worldwide on PC and consoles.
About the Position:
We are looking for a visionary Art Director to establish the game's unique visual identity. This is an opportunity to create a distinctive aesthetic inspired by Emirati culture, blending authenticity with a modern indie-game sensibility. As the Art Director, you will collaborate closely with our Emirati artists, cultural partners, and storytelling team to ensure that the game's visuals reflect the beauty, richness, and traditions of the UAE.
You will also play a crucial role in defining an efficient art pipeline that utilizes Unreal Engine's tools and workflows, while keeping the project within scope and budget.
This is a hands-on leadership position in which you will build and mentor a small, globally distributed art team, guiding them in developing a cohesive and visually striking world that enhances the gameplay experience. A unique opportunity for someone based in the region or open to relocating or traveling to Abu Dhabi during development to immerse themselves in the local stories, landscapes, and traditions.
As our Art Director, you will be responsible for …
- Visual Direction: Define and develop a unique art style inspired by Emirati culture that balances authenticity and technical feasibility within the game's scope. Oversee all visual aspects of the game, including environment design, character art, animation direction, lighting, and UI aesthetics.
- Team Building & Mentorship: Build a small, distributed team from the ground up; serve as a mentor to local Emirati artists and other team members.
- Cross-Disciplinary Collaboration: Collaborate closely with the Game Design Director, Narrative Lead, and other team members to align art direction with gameplay and storytelling goals.
- Hands-on Art Production: Work directly in Unreal Engine to prototype, iterate, and optimize assets, ensuring a balance between visual fidelity and performance.
- Asset Oversight: Manage the creation of art assets, ensuring consistency, quality, and alignment with the game's unique look and feel.
- Pipeline & Budget Management: Develop and optimize art workflows and Unreal Engine pipelines to balance artistic ambition and ensure high-quality visuals while staying within budget and production constraints.
- Cultural Integration: Translate authentic elements of Emirati culture into visually compelling assets, art styles, and environments. Collaborate with other Emirati artists and cultural experts to ensure the game's visual design reflects the heritage, traditions, and aesthetics of the UAE.
- Iterative Development: Engage in continuous review, feedback, and refinement of art assets through playtesting and cross-disciplinary collaboration.
